Nancy Rafferty-Jones

Nancy Rafferty-Jones is an English prof who writes, photographs the world, and plays a mean game of basketball.  She teaches Women's Lit, British Lit, World Lit and Comp.  Her research bent is postcolonial and she has a strong interest in gender studies and popular culture.  She is a firm believer in always being frivolous and never being trivial.  As Doug Coupland said, life "doesn't have to be a story but it does have to be an adventure."  LFG, people.
